>>> It seems to be only failing for the 64-bit builds - and there only for
>>> the PPC970 CPU (which is the default for the mac99 machine in 64-bit
>>> builds):
>>>
>>> qemu-system-ppc64 -nographic -cpu 750 -M mac99 ==> works fine
>>>
>>> qemu-system-ppc64 -nographic -cpu 970 -M mac99 ==> hangs
>>
>>
>> This is too brutal :
>>
>> +    /* This instruction doesn't exist anymore on 64-bit server
>> +     * processors compliant with arch 2.x
>> +     */
>> +    if (ctx->insns_flags & PPC_SEGMENT_64B) {
>> +        gen_inval_exception(ctx, POWERPC_EXCP_INVAL_INVAL);
>> +        return;
>> +    }
>>
>> There are a couple of instructions which have been deleted from 
>> ISA 2.x. rfi is one of them. Could we use a insn_flag to filter
>> them  ? 
> 
> According to the PPC970FX user manual that I have:
> 
> "The 970FX does not provide support for the following optional or
>  obsolete instructions (or instruction forms).
>  Attempted use of these will result in an illegal instruction type
>  program interrupt.
>   [...]
>   · rfi - Return from interrupt (obsolete) "
> 
> So if OpenBIOS is using this instruction in 970 mode, it's maybe
> OpenBIOS that should be fixed instead?

If 970 doesn't implement rfi, OpenBIOS shouldn't use it, yes :).
